Former New Orleans Saints wide receiver Brandin Cooks officially cleared waivers yesterday, which means he’s now free to sign with any team he wants. A first-round pick in the 2014 NFL Draft, Cooks used to be one of the game’s premier deep threats, recording 1,000-yard seasons with the Saints, New England Patriots, Los Angeles Rams, and Houston Texans. While the veteran has lost a step in his later year, he could be an intriguing depth piece for the right organization.
